Target Audience:
This
presentation is targeting pharmacists who manage and monitor patients receiving
antiarrhythmic drugs. Emphasis will be given to arrhythmias common to the
elderly population.
Learning Objectives:
At the conclusion of this Application-Based activity, participants should
be able to:
- Discuss the major mechanism of arrhythmia generation.
- Differentiate the role of antiarrhythmic drugs compared to electrical treatment for both atrial and ventricular arrhythmias.
- List the primary use and monitoring parameters for the Class I and III antiarrhythmic drugs.
- Formulate a treatment plan for a patient with atrial fibrillation.
- Analyze the medical record for a patient on amiodarone to optimize safety.
